In literacy this week we are continuing to practise writing and representing our names in different ways. Our phonological awareness focus is on syllabification (breaking down the syllables in words), rhyme and recognising ‘what a word is’ and how many words can be in a sentence. In bookmaking, the children published and shared their books on ‘About Me’. In phonics, we are learning the names and sounds of the letters S, A, T. In Numeracy, we are continuing to practise the ‘principles of counting’. We counted small objects placed in cups and the children displayed their counting knowledge ie. ‘I can count each object only once and say one number name for each object’, ‘When I count, I say the numbers in order’, ‘When I count the objects in a group, the last number I say tells me the total for the group’, ‘It doesn’t matter which order I count a group of objects in, the total will be the same’.
